An Electronic Travel Authorization (ETA) is an electronic system that allows travelers to obtain authorization to enter a country before departure, typically through an online application process. It serves as a pre-approval measure to enhance border security and streamline entry procedures, replacing traditional visa processes for eligible travelers.
Key Features
- Online application process for travelers
- Pre-arrival authorization requirement
- Typically valid for multiple entries over a set period
- Speeds up immigration procedures at entry points
- Automated background checks and security screening
- Applicable mainly to short-term visits like tourism, business, or transit
Pros
- Simplifies and accelerates the travel authorization process
- Reduces wait times at border control
- Enhances security through electronic screening
- Convenient online submission from anywhere
- Cost-effective compared to traditional visas
Cons
- Requires internet access and digital literacy
- Processing times can vary, leading to uncertainties if not applied in advance
- Not available for all countries or types of travel
- Potential technical issues or data privacy concerns
- May be rejected based on security or immigration risk factors
